CH
Chipex
View company profile →
Slow Delivery, Great Product
9 days post ordering and still no sign of the order. Edit: Product arrived 2 weeks after ordering. Does exactly what it's supposed to.
View company profile →
9 days post ordering and still no sign of the order. Edit: Product arrived 2 weeks after ordering. Does exactly what it's supposed to.